Transaction 7571e68cc33728fe8fa052dc17f2ba0d53f51c93a53ab852b0f7b2e863cec086

2 Input
2 Outputs
  • 7571e68cc33728fe8fa052dc17f2ba0d53f51c93a53ab852b0f7b2e863cec086:0
  • value  812859824
    address  3CcHpaaU3B2NT4oeaX5Am1U9NCx7M7iGtR
  • 7571e68cc33728fe8fa052dc17f2ba0d53f51c93a53ab852b0f7b2e863cec086:1
  • value  16998000
    address  1AaSeHZhrQQHnPnadsoGEhrQyXe1GwyUFY